My colleague says that we should respect the rulemaking process. Maybe some of my colleagues here in Washington don't understand, don't recognize, won't acknowledge that this government has gotten too big, and the rulemaking process is really meant to shut out voices across America. It is we here in Congress who should be making these rules, not unelected bureaucrats who have no accountability to the people that they impose these rules upon. It is we who should be doing this. By the way, there were some folks who came in, they said, We oppose your amendment. We want this emergency braking system on trucks. I said, Well, how about on your trucks? Oh, no, no, we don't want it on our trucks. We want it on their trucks. We want it on someone else's trucks. Everybody wants someone else to pay the freight until it comes to their doorstep, then they are not interested. Mr. Chairman, this government is too big. This is an example of it. I urge adoption of this amendment, and I yield back the balance of my time. The Acting CHAIR. The question is on the amendment offered by the gentleman from Pennsylvania (Mr. Perry). The amendment was agreed to. Amendment No. 72 Offered by Mr. Roy The Acting CHAIR. It is now in order to consider amendment No. 72 printed in part B of House Report 118-261.
